Nashua Climate
Nashua has an average annual temperature of 8.7°C (48°F) and receives about 1093 mm of precipitation per year. The warmest month is July and the coldest is January. Figures are 1970–2000 climate normals.

| Month | Avg (°C/°F) | Precip |
|---|---|---|
| January | -5° / 22° | 86 mm |
| February | -4° / 25° | 80 mm |
| March | 1° / 34° | 90 mm |
| April | 7° / 45° | 93 mm |
| May | 14° / 56° | 91 mm |
| June | 19° / 65° | 89 mm |
| July | 22° / 71° | 87 mm |
| August | 21° / 70° | 89 mm |
| September | 17° / 62° | 85 mm |
| October | 10° / 50° | 94 mm |
| November | 5° / 41° | 112 mm |
| December | -1° / 29° | 97 mm |
1970–2000 normals from WorldClim 2.1 (~9 km grid). Precipitation can be less precise near mountains or coastlines, where rainfall varies sharply over short distances.
Best time to visit Nashua
The most comfortable months to visit Nashua are typically August, July and June, when temperatures are mildest and rainfall is relatively low. The hottest month is July (around 28°C high). The coldest is January (near -11°C low). November is usually the wettest month.
